The Gen 6 Glock introduces significant physical and functional upgrades over previous generations. Key enhancements include a new hybrid grip texture (RTF2/RTF4), interchangeable palm swells, a deeper trigger guard undercut, and thumb ledges for improved ergonomics and recoil management. All models are optics-ready with a standardized mounting system, and feature a new flat-face trigger and deeper slide serrations. These changes, driven partly by legal pressures related to firearm modifications, represent a substantial evolution for the Glock platform.

Frequently Asked Questions

What are the main physical upgrades in the Glock Gen 6?

The Glock Gen 6 features a new hybrid grip texture (RTF2/RTF4), interchangeable palm swells, a deeper trigger guard undercut, thumb ledges for better control, a flat-face trigger, and deeper front slide serrations.

Are Glock Gen 6 models optics-ready?

Yes, all Gen 6 Glock models are optics-ready and utilize a standardized 3-plate system to accommodate popular red dot sights, eliminating the need for a separate MOS configuration.

Why did Glock make internal changes for the Gen 6 and V Model?

Internal geometry changes, particularly around the striker lug, were implemented to make it more difficult to modify firearms for full-auto fire, likely in response to legal pressures from gun control advocates.

Can I use barrels from older Glock generations with a Gen 6?

No, barrels are not interchangeable between Gen 6 Glocks and previous generations (Gen 1-5) due to the internal geometry modifications associated with the V Model updates.
